Whickham School is seeking a Senior Administrative Assistant to ensure effective operation of the school office and manage the MIS. The role entails organizing staff cover for lessons and assisting with Sixth Form administration, alongside providing support during school holidays.
Ideal candidates will possess excellent organizational skills and the ability to work calmly in a busy environment. The position includes benefits such as professional development opportunities and a supportive work atmosphere.
